Rotating a photo in 90-degree increments has GOT to be one of the most common actions people take with their iPhone photos…
And yet:
- Photos on the phone: Multiple taps, buried in an edit mode, and the whole photo has to slowly “load” first
- Photos on the Mac: Command-R on the grid is VERY slow to execute, gives no feedback, and often drops repeated Cmd-Rs instead of queuing them
Does everyone at Apple just get photo orientation right on the first try, every time? Why is this so bad?
